There is a push to repopularize breadfruit (ulu) again in Hawaii. They lost favor and were considered poor man's food for long time after european foods were introduced. It's a difficult goal to get people to try it and bring it into their diets. Most people here have either never eaten it or eat it very little. I myself love it and find it to be very versatile fruit. Also a very beautiful tree. Biggest drawback with it is it ripens very fast--you have to prepare it very soon after picking.
